当前位置: 首页 > 面试题库 >

Django:关联“ django_site”不存在

谭向晨
2023-03-14
问题内容

我正在aws上运行django测试服务器,并且刚刚安装了django-userena,当我尝试单击“提交”以注册用户时,收到以下消息:

关系“ django_site”不存在第1行:…“ django_site”。“域”,“ django_site”。“名称”来自“ django_si …

我不太确定这里出了什么问题。我做了一些研究并将其添加" 'django.contrib.sites',"到已安装的应用程序中,但是仍然出现错误。我将缺少一个额外的步骤。有什么建议或建议吗?


问题答案:

即使SITE_ID = 1在设置中,我最近也遇到了这个问题(Django 1.8.7)。我必须先手动迁移sites应用程序,然后再进行其他迁移:

./manage.py migrate sites
./manage.py migrate


 类似资料:
  • 嗨,我是新来的拉威尔,在理解如何建立人际关系方面有点挣扎。我试图在laravel中创建一个基本的restful api,有3个模型 表迁移: 书籍是主要的表格,作者与书籍有一对多的关系。类别与书籍有多对多的关系,因为一本书可以在多个类别中。 books表有一个author_id字段将其链接到author表。还有一个名为category_books的透视表,它包含category_id和book_i

  • 对容器类型为泛型的 trait 有类型规范需要——trait 的成员必须指出全部关于它的泛型类型。 在下面例子中,Contains trait 允许使用泛型类型 A 或 B。然后这个 trait 针对 Container 类型实现,指定 i32 为 A 和 B,因而它可以用到 fn difference()。(本段原文:In the example below, the Contains trai

  • 问题内容: 我有两个具有双向@OneToOne映射的类。 我需要编写代码来检索B的所有实例,这些实例没有与之关联的A实例。我还需要为所有没有B的A编写类似的查询。 我努力了: 但这似乎总是返回null。有什么想法吗? 问题答案: 这对两个方向都应该起作用:

  • 我创建了一个自定义的推送()方法,它以级联的方式保存所有模型的关系,并收集实体和子实体详细信息的完整快照用于审计日志。 一切都与belongsTo配合良好,并且有很多关系。我只是这样做: 但问题在于他只有一种关系。它不提供任何方法将相关模型附加到我的根模型而不首先保存它。HasOne关系在Laravel中只有save()方法: 如您所见,它不仅关联,而且保存了模型。为了能够检测字段的所有更改,我的

  • 问题内容: 我删除了一些与应用程序相关的表。再试一次syncdb命令 它显示错误 models.py 我该如何获取该应用程序的表格? 问题答案: 删除表(您已经做过), 在model.py中注释掉模型, 和.. 如果Django版本> = 1.7: 其他 在models.py中注释模型 转到步骤3。 但是 这次没有 --fake

  • 问题内容: 我删除了一些与应用程序相关的表。再试一次syncdb命令 它显示错误 models.py 我该如何获取该应用程序的表格? 问题答案: 删除表(你已经做过), 在model.py中注释掉模型, 和.. 如果Django版本> = 1.7: 其他 在models.py中注释模型 转到步骤3。但是这次没有–fake